The opportunity

Built, equipped, inspected — and idle.

PBS-0417 is a non-operating cGMP sterile compounding facility in Southern California, purpose-built between 2015 and 2018 and FDA-inspected in 2019. It ran roughly a year of sterile production before pausing, and is offered fully built-out and equipped — ready to restart or convert.

The value is in what is already standing: three ISO 7 cleanroom suites, a 1,000-litre-per-hour Water-for-Injection system, and a documented FDA inspection history. It is positioned for financial sponsors and for strategic buyers — hospitals expanding into 503B, or pharmacies adding sterile and 503A capacity.
